About this listen
He didn’t just think. He built the tools for thinking. Born in Macedon.
Trained by Plato. Tutor to Alexander the Great. But more than anything, Aristotle was a blueprint engineer. A mind that broke reality into categories, causes, and systems that still shape the world today.
This is the full map of Aristotle’s legacy. Across logic, biology, politics, metaphysics, ethics, storytelling, and more.
He didn’t give us the answers. He gave us the frameworks to figure them out.
